Are Bulldogs A Good Dog?

Dependable and predictable, the bulldog is a

wonderful family pet

and loving to most children People-oriented as a breed, they actively solicit human attention. However, they have retained the courage that was originally bred into them for bull baiting, so they make fine watchdogs.

How do bull dogs look?

Bulldogs come in a variety of colors:

red brindle

; all other brindles; solid white; solid red, fawn, or fallow (pale cream to light fawn, pale yellow, or yellow red; and piebald (large patches of two or more colors). Solid black isn’t common and isn’t much admired.

How much does a bulldog cost?

$1,000-$6,000 An English Bulldog from a reputable breeder can cost anywhere from $1,000 to $6,000+. The total cost depends on the area you live in, the quality of the puppies, and the breeder’s rates.

Do bulldogs bark?

Bulldogs seldom bark , but that doesn’t mean they aren’t noisy. They make a symphony of snorts and snores. Their bark is low and gruff, deep when compared to other small and medium dogs. English bulldogs usually only bark when startled by unknown strangers or other disturbances.

Is a Bulldog a pitbull?

Is a Bulldog a Pit Bull? No, a Bulldog is not considered a Pit Bull Breeders crossed the Bulldog with the Terrier for the

muscular body

of a bulldog and the agility of a terrier. The Pit Bull is recognized as part of the terrier family, but both breeds have Old English Bulldog in their lineage.

Do bulldogs shed?

All-in-all, bulldogs can be considered “average” shedders Bulldogs have a short, fine, smooth coat. The good news about this is that when they do shed, it can make cleanup a relatively simple job. The coat also matures with age, and a bulldog puppy will typically shed more than the adult version later in their life.

Is a pug a Bulldog?

They Are Not Related To Bulldogs DNA testing has proven that Bulldogs and Pugs are not actually related. The Pug does have the same stocky shape, flat face and wrinkles as the Bulldog, but Pugs share their origins with the Pekingese, not the Bulldog.

Are Bulldogs smart?

Intelligence. According to this intelligence ranking, bulldogs rank as 77 and French Bulldogs rank at 58. Bulldogs rank at the lowest degree of working/obedience intelligence. It says they understand new commands after 80-100 tries and obey the first command 25% of the time or worse.

Are Bulldogs noisy?

Bulldogs are often known as noisy dogs , not because they bark, but because they grunt, snore, and snort. And you may be wondering why on earth they are so loud. Not only do they breathe hard, bulldogs are known to snore, and be extremely noisy eaters.

Which is better pug or Bulldog?

Pugs tend to be more active and alert, relishing opportunities for play Bulldogs do play, but they are typically content taking it easy. Pugs are smaller than English Bulldogs, but both are okay living in small spaces. Pugs are more prone to excessive barking than Bulldogs.

Can bulldogs be left alone all day?

Yes, bulldogs can be left alone but only when they’re well trained and confident Because they’re companion dogs, they thrive on being close to their family. If left alone too long, they experience separation anxiety which may lead to destructive behavior.

Are bulldogs high maintenance?

Bulldogs aren’t the healthiest of breeds. Health issues affecting them contribute to high maintenance levels , in terms of veterinary care and accompanying bills. They’re prone to allergies, skin diseases, bladder stones, eye problems and respiratory issues.
